As California continues to slowly count ballots, edging closer to determining who will advance in elections to run the state and its largest city, Donald Trump and other Republicans are spreading claims of election fraud that have become common after California elections.
On Monday, Trump-backed Republican Steve Hilton was inching closer to securing the second runoff spot in the California governor’s race, after Democrat Xavier Becerra secured the first spot on Friday. But the race has yet to be called for Hilton, with more than 2.5m ballots still left to be counted across the state.
In the Los Angeles mayoral race, progressive city councillor Nithya Raman and reality TV star Spencer Pratt, a registered Republican, were in a close race to challenge incumbent mayor Karen Bass, who advanced to the runoff on election night.
